Sustainability and Eco-friendliness
Bamboo fabric has been gaining traction in the fashion industry due to its sustainable and eco-friendly qualities. As a fast-growing plant, bamboo is easily renewable and does not require the use of pesticides or chemicals to thrive. This makes it an ideal material for environmentally conscious fashion brands looking to reduce their ecological footprint.
Softness and Comfort
One of the main attractions of bamboo fabric is its luxurious softness and comfort. The fibers of bamboo fabric are naturally smooth and round, making them gentle on the skin and perfect for creating comfortable and breathable clothing. Versatility and Durability
Bamboo fabric is known for its versatility and durability. It can be woven into various textures, from silky smooth to crisp and tailored, making it suitable for a wide range of clothing items such as shirts, dresses, and even accessories. Additionally, bamboo fabric is highly durable, with strong fibers that can withstand regular wear and tear, ensuring longevity in the wardrobe.

Challenges and Future Opportunities
While the rising popularity of bamboo fabric in fashion is promising, there are challenges that need to be addressed to ensure its continued success. These include the need for efficient manufacturing processes to meet growing demand, as well as the development of sustainable dyeing and finishing techniques to minimize environmental impact. The future opportunities lie in continued research and development to expand the versatility of bamboo fabric, as well as fostering collaborations between fashion industry stakeholders to promote responsible production and consumption.
